All tickets are available from members\, or through our website www.bravadoshowchoir.com \n  \nBravado’s Musical production team consists of Musical Director\, Ellen Wells\, Artistic Director Marianne Derow\, and Accompanist Nena Lamarre. \n  \nBravado Show Choir is generously sponsored by the City of Barrie\, and Barrie Charity Bingo Association. \n  \nAbout Bravado! \n  \nBravado!\, Barrie’s show choir\, was formed in 1996 with a vision of creating a multi-artistic experience. Under the musical direction of Ellen Wells\, the choir continually challenges traditional notions of choral music by layering vocal excellence with the visual appeal of staging and choreography. Bravado! performs all music from memory\, getting “off the page” and allowing a more personal connection with their audience. Bravado’s choral fusion style transitions fluently from classical through Gospel\, Jazz\, and Broadway\, to Rock without sacrificing musical excellence. \n  \nJoin us for “Mistletones” and experience the magic of the season through music\, community spirit\, and unforgettable memories!

DESCRIPTION:In this sharp\, satirical\, comedy\, the first play produced on Broadway written by a Native American woman\, four (very) well-intentioned theatre people walk into a high school drama classroom. The work at hand: creating a First Thanksgiving pageant for elementary school students to celebrate Native American Heritage Month that won’t ruffle any feathers.
